For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public elementary school serving 1,004 students in the neighborhood of Cypress Village, Irvine, CA.
The neighborhood of Cypress Village, Irvine, CA public elementary schools have a diversity score of 0.56, which is less than the California public elementary school average of 0.64.
Minority enrollment is 82% of the student body (majority Asian), which is more than the California public elementary school average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
